How to fill out the CA IMM 5620 online
Filling out the CA IMM 5620 form is an essential step in applying for permanent residence in Canada. This guide provides you with clear and comprehensive instructions to help you complete the form accurately and efficiently.
Follow the steps to fill out the CA IMM 5620 correctly.
- Click the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the online editor.
- Carefully read the fee payment instructions. Calculate the applicable fees by referring to the provided fee table based on the number of applicants and their categories.
- Select the appropriate payment method. You can pay by certified cheque, bank draft, money order, or credit card. Make sure to complete sections A and B as required for your chosen payment method.
- In Section A, clearly provide the name and address of the principal applicant and the payer, if different. This ensures accurate processing of your form.
- If paying by credit card, fill out Section B with the correct credit card details, including the card number, expiry date, and card security value code. Ensure the amount matches the total fees calculated in Step 2.
- Double-check all entered information for accuracy. Ensure that your credit card details are valid for the necessary duration to avoid application delays.
- Once completed, save your changes and select your preferred option to download, print, or share the form as necessary.

Who needs to fill IMM 5409?
The IMM 5409 – Statutory Declaration of Common-law Union, is an application form that people who wish to include their common-law spouses in their immigration applications must complete. There are several programs available that allow family members to sponsor each other for residency in Canada.
What is the IMM 5669e schedule a background declaration?
The IMM 5669 form, also known as the "Schedule A – Background/Declaration" form, is required to be filed by individuals applying for permanent residence in Canada. This form is meant to provide information about the applicant's background, such as criminal history, immigration history, and personal details.
Who needs to fill IMM 5669?
IMM 5669 Schedule A Background Declaration The principal applicant (your parent or grandparent) The principal applicant's spouse or common-law partner, whether they are coming to Canada or not (your other parent or grandparent, or your parent's or grandparent's spouse)
